The old Angela Dede (Matilda Obaseki) vs the new Angela Dede (Leonora Okhine)

Her real name is Leonora Okhine a Ghanian prior to coming to Nigeria had probably never watched Tinsel because her own portrayal of Angela Dede is off point and not convince able. Matilda Obaseki who had formally played the role of Angela Dede  has garnered award nominations for her role as Angela especially given the challenges involved in playing the role of a troubled yet determined mentally ill young woman with dignity rather than a caricature. The actress announced her engagement in March 2012 while pregnant with a 1st child. No official word from M-Net on if this is a permanent or temporary change. This is not the 1st btim e the series has has swapped one of its leading actresses, the role of Amaka Okoh and Brenda Mensah have both been recast. The former Amaka played by Uzo Egereonu was pregnant and emigrated to Canada. The old Brenda(Juliet Asante) left due to unforeseen circumstances. Reginald Okoh played by Omar Captan Shariff was killed off the show because he was giving them a lot of diva attitude.
